Weather in August

August, the last month of the summer in Franklin, is also a moderately hot month, with an average temperature fluctuating between 66.7°F (19.3°C) and 85.5°F (29.7°C).

Temperature

At the onset of August, Franklin records an average high-temperature of a warm 85.5°F (29.7°C), showing little deviation from the preceding month. An average low-temperature of 66.7°F (19.3°C) is anticipated throughout the nights in Franklin during August.

Heat index

The heat index value for August is estimated at a fiery hot 96.8°F (36°C). Take more caution, heat exhaustion and heat cramps may occur. Long-lasting activity may cause heatstroke.
Understanding the heat index involves considering values for shaded locales with light wind. Direct sunlight exposure may result in a rise of the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'feels like', is a measure that combines air temperature and relative humidity into a single value that indicates how hot the weather feels. Factors encompassing physical activity, clothing, and metabolic differences have a role in shaping the individual's impression of temperature. Direct sun rays can make one feel hotter, potentially raising the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are especially vital to children. Children frequently underestimate the importance of resting and drinking fluids. Thirst is a symptom of advanced dehydration - hence the need to hydrate regularly, especially during protracted physical exercises.
The body's inherent cooling system operates through perspiration, wherein evaporating sweat offsets excessive heat. In situations of high air temperature combined with high humidity (significant heat index), the body's ability to perspire is reduced, heightening the sense of warmth. Elevated heat gain compared to the body's release capability poses risks of dehydration and potential overheating.

Humidity

In August, the average relative humidity in Franklin is 76%.

Rainfall

In August, in Franklin, the rain falls for 17.3 days. Throughout August, 3.5" (89mm) of precipitation is accumulated. Throughout the year, in Franklin, there are 171.5 rainfall days, and 37.2" (945m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

In Franklin, Kentucky, the average length of the day in August is 13h and 31min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 5:52 am and sunset at 7:52 pm. On the last day of August, in Franklin, sunrise is at 6:17 am and sunset at 7:15 pm CDT.

Sunshine

The months with the most sunshine are June and August, with an average of 10.4h of sunshine.

UV index

May through August, with an average maximum UV index of 6, are months with the highest UV index in Franklin. A UV Index reading of 6 to 7 represents a high health hazard from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for ordinary individuals.
Note: The daily high UV index of 6 in August translates into this advice:
Use measures and accept sun safety conventions. Guarding against skin and eye trauma is of high priority. Avoid direct exposure to the Sun between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., the peak period for UV radiation, noting that objects like parasols or canopies might not offer complete sun protection. A wide-brimmed hat is a staple for defending the face, eyes, ears, and neck from the Sun.
